Menzies’ Wartime Tour – England (1941) - Clip 4: Dedication of the Shrine of Remembrance
This clip begins with a wide shot of the Shrine of Remembrance, Melbourne and ex-servicemen and children arriving for the dedication of the shrine forecourt. The Australian flag is shown hanging next to the Union Jack. Queen Elizabeth II arrives with Prince Philip, the Duke of Edinburgh and they walk through the crowd to the forecourt where they commemorate those that served in the Second World War by the Eternal Flame.
